  • Hi

    I have had a reply back to my most recent request for a CCA

    We apologise for the delat in responding to your request under section 78 for Consumer Credit ACt 1974. We will write to you regarding your request in due course.

    We note that your account was acquired from another lender some time ago. As such we need to obtain documentation from that lender; as soon as this is received we will forward it to you.

    In the meantime, you should continue to make payments to your account. We believe that this is consistent with the egal position (as recently confirmed in the case of McGuffick v the Royal Bank of Scotland plc) that, even in circumstances where a lender has not complied with a request under the Act, the lender can continue to demand payments be made to that account, and any arrears will be reported to the Credit Reference Agencies and the use of any card(s) may be withdrawn

    We acknowledge some of our customers, cqn fall into financial difficulty....blah blah blah blah..
